Online Casino Field: Overview and Key Features

The online casino industry constitutes a considerable section of digital amusement, creating billions in yearly income worldwide. This sector appeared in the mid-1990s when technical improvements enabled operators to introduce digital gambling systems accessible through internet links. Today, the market encompasses thousands of authorized platforms presenting gaming sessions to millions of enrolled players.

Contemporary casino sites function through complex software systems that replicate traditional gambling dynamics in digital environments. These systems use random number generators to secure just outcomes, payment processing infrastructure to handle payments, and client relationship utilities to keep player records. Operators invest in technology infrastructure to offer uninterrupted experiences while sustaining migliori casino online non aams operational effectiveness and legal adherence.

The field structure comprises multiple parties: platform operators who oversee sites, software programmers who develop gaming material, payment providers who facilitate payments, and oversight entities who oversee legal adherence. Operators license games from developers, combine third-party payment systems, and acquire approvals from verification agencies.

Legal Status and Licensing in Diverse Regions

Online gambling legislation fluctuates dramatically across global regions, creating a intricate legal terrain. Some jurisdictions uphold full prohibitions on online wagering, while others have created comprehensive licensing systems. European nations like Malta, Gibraltar, and the Isle of Man have developed robust oversight frameworks that draw international operators pursuing reliable permits.

Licensing authorities apply stringent criteria on candidates before issuing operational authorizations. Regulators assess monetary stability, technological framework, responsible gambling regulations, and anti-money laundering procedures. Licensed operators must pay significant costs, undergo to routine inspections, and maintain minimum capital reserves to safeguard player funds. The United Kingdom Gambling Commission and Malta Gaming Authority constitute two of the most esteemed oversight bodies.

Jurisdictional differences produce challenges for operators targeting worldwide users. Some areas require domestic licensing for market admission, while others recognize international licenses. Operators must manage different tax systems, advertising restrictions, and adherence requirements. Security and Data Safeguarding in Online Casinos

Casino systems implement multiple security layers to secure private player data and monetary payments. Encryption technology establishes the cornerstone of information protection, with providers deploying SSL credentials to protect transmissions between player devices and platform servers. This encryption blocks unpermitted parties from obtaining personal data, payment authentication, or account information during transfer.

Verification systems verify player identities and stop unauthorized account access. Systems mandate strong credentials, deploy two-factor authentication, and observe login trends for dubious conduct. Know Your Customer protocols demand identity confirmation through record filing, confirming players meet age criteria and conform with anti-money laundering rules. Payment security receives specific attention considering the economic nature of casino functions. Providers work with verified payment processors who maintain PCI DSS adherence standards. Many sites utilize tokenization platforms that substitute confidential information with protected references. Periodic security audits executed by autonomous firms detect flaws and guarantee defensive steps meet field criteria.

Game Catalogs: From Traditional Slots to Current Game Programs

Modern casino platforms provide broad game libraries presenting thousands of titles across various genres. Slot machines dominate most catalogs, spanning from classic three-reel formats to complex video slots with various paylines, extra elements, and progressive jackpots. Software programmers launch fresh slot games frequently, integrating diverse topics from ancient civilizations to popular culture nods.

Table games represent another critical genre, with digital formats of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ker accessible in many variations. Many sites provide both standard electronic formats and live operator choices where actual croupiers run games via video broadcast technology, producing an absorbing experience that connects virtual and physical gambling spaces.

Recent years have witnessed the appearance of game show-style options that combine amusement components with gambling mechanics. Titles like Crazy Time and Monopoly Live include lively hosts, rotating wheels, and reward sessions resembling television shows. These developments draw players pursuing participatory experiences beyond conventional casino offerings. VIP Schemes, Reward Schemes and Player Engagement

Casino providers implement reward schemes to encourage sustained activity and recognize frequent members. These systems typically include hierarchical frameworks where players accumulate points through wagering activity and move through bronze, silver, gold, and platinum levels. Each stage provides further advantages such as quicker withdrawal handling, assigned account handlers, private rewards, and offers to special events.

VIP schemes aim at premium players who create significant income through regular deposits and lengthy play periods. Providers designate dedicated account managers to VIP users, providing individualized support and addressing problems swiftly. Elite players obtain personalized campaigns, higher deposit thresholds, and entry to restricted competitions with substantial award funds. Marketing Strategies: Affiliates, Incentives and Promotions

Affiliate promotion comprises a primary customer obtainment channel for online casinos. Providers collaborate with website proprietors, material developers, and advertising specialists who market casino brands to their audiences. Partners earn commissions based on directed players, generally through income share structures or cost-per-acquisition arrangements. Sign-up incentives function as powerful inducements for new player enrollment and initial contributions. Common promotions include deposit matches where providers provide reward funds equivalent to a share of the initial deposit, or free rotation bundles for slot titles. Operators create incentive conditions with wagering conditions that harmonize player benefit against business viability.

Active marketing initiatives maintain player participation past first sign-up. Deposit bonuses recognize established clients making further payments, while refund offers repay percentages of losses during designated intervals. Seasonal promotions tied to holidays or athletic competitions generate enthusiasm and promote elevated engagement. Threats and Difficulties: Compulsion, Fraud and Compliance

Compulsive gambling comprises a substantial social concern linked with online casino operations. The accessibility and ease of internet-based systems can worsen addictive behaviors, with some players cultivating unhealthy associations with gambling activities. Responsible operators implement self-ban tools, deposit caps, and reality checks that inform users to period spent participating. Many systems partner with agencies specializing in gambling addiction help to supply tools and counseling connections.

Dishonest activities create persistent difficulties for operators and players equally. Payment scams, reward abuse, and account compromises necessitate continuous monitoring and sophisticated discovery mechanisms. Providers implement machine learning models to identify questionable behaviors such as multiple accounts generated from same IP locations or unusual wagering behaviors.
